- [ ] Off-site run, Thursday: collect the sealed exam-paper crate from the Norwick Training Centre print room. Verify the tamper seals are intact and note seal numbers on the run sheet before loading. Crate travels alone in the cab-side cage, not the main bay. On arrival at Halden Hall, the courier follows the hand-over instruction below.

courier memo of yawep-yafog: the pramir ulaix courier leaves the ulavan aldix frair zorok oliiel joreth rusdor fenvan ledger at gate 1305 under passcode 514738

### Websocket compression (Larkspool gateway)

Quick reminder: permessage-deflate saves bandwidth but chews CPU on the gateway pods, and it made the Marbleton outage worse last quarter. If clients report lag, consider disabling compression before scaling up. It's a per-tier toggle, so don't flip it globally without a heads-up. The settings currently in effect are as follows.

deployment values, bahof-badug:
[rusix]
team = zorok
access_code = ac_641cbe
owner = ulair.tamius
host = rusix.torvasoft.local
port = 5672
peer = ulaix.sivrelworks.internal
salt = 1df570ed
pin = 6327

Ticket: Fixturesmith can't connect in CI

Heads up for the new folks — if you're seeing connection timeouts when Fixturesmith (our test-data factory library) tries to seed the ephemeral database, it's almost always because the CI runner spins up before the database container finishes init. The fix is to bump the retry count in the factory config, not to hardcode sleeps (we've been burned by that). Once the container is healthy, Fixturesmith should be pointed at it using the connection string below.

warehouse DSN: mssql://quenir_svc:SvJukdQ74VnW1L@db-151e.ferraworks.corp:5432/raldor

## Idempotency Keys for Payment Retries (Lumopay)

Every retry of a charge request must reuse the original idempotency key; generating a new key on retry can produce duplicate charges. Keys are scoped per merchant and expire after 48 hours. Reviewers should verify keys are derived server-side, never from client input. The full key-generation specification and threat model are maintained on the internal page.

dashboard of kaguf-tawip = https://vault.merlaqsys.test/issue